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2
The NM_206933.4(USH2A):c.9723C>T(p.Tyr3241Tyr)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00119 in 1,613,840 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 17 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

Tyr3241Tyr in exon 49 of USH2A: This variant is not expected to have clinical si gnificance because it does not alter an amino acid residue, is not located withi n the splice consensus sequence, has been identified in 2% (73/3738) of African American chromosomes from a broad population by the NHLBI Exome sequencing proje ct (http://evs.gs.washington.edu/EVS/; dbSNP rs6660707). -
